Problem
Embezzlements continue. Law enforcement officers in Virginia estimate that a recently retired priest may have embezzled more than $1 million from two rural churches. Rev Rodney L. Rodis was recently arrested at his home which he shares with Joyce F Sillador and three children. He and Sillador have been living together since at least 1998 according to court records. Read more.

Progress
A recent editorial in the Palm Beach Post praised the local affiliate of Voice of the Faithful for working with the diocese to help establish practices to achieve financial accountability and transparency in a diocese that has been rocked by embezzlement scandals. See Vineyard 10/05/06

The editorial stated: “The diocese has helped restore credibility by working with Voice of the Faithful, a Boston-based reform group that advocates financial transparency and accountability on other church problems such as sexual abuse by priests. Peter Amann of Palm Beach Gardens, chairman of Voice of the Faithful in Palm Beach County, wants to open lines of communication: ‘Our goal is to establish a collaborative dialogue among the faithful and the hierarchy.’"
